Output 25a3e0da2df660de99541623c504be6f0ac54d4e2a5ec68f2ba9a48af47e283b:0

value
64514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243ff40339aa3df1b0e0e88f4616b56e36454715 OP_EQUAL
address
34zgrzcPJ17m9ruzaqX6Dz1DSxn1AgHuH8
transaction
25a3e0da2df660de99541623c504be6f0ac54d4e2a5ec68f2ba9a48af47e283b
spent
true